Choosing Final Waypoint

Normally you use the last waypoint in a monitored route as the final waypoint, and the ECDIS automatically does
this when you choose the route to monitor. However, sometimes you may prefer to use some other waypoint as the
final waypoint of a monitored route.
To choose a waypoint as final waypoint, do the following:
1. Open the Monitor Route dialog box; choose Route from the status bar, then click the Monitor button.
2. Place the cursor in the Final WP box; spin the scrollwheel to choose a waypoint.
3. Push the scrollwheel to confirm your selection.

Viewing Waypoint Information

You can view waypoint information for the monitored
route by clicking the Waypoints tab in the Monitor
Route dialog box. This information is printed from route
planning information made for this voyage.
"TO WP" and "NEXT WP" are indicated on this list.
